Landfill Reduction
One major benefit of dumpster compactors is that they help decrease the amount of waste sent to landfills. By compacting trash, you can reduce the volume of garbage generated, which means landfills can last longer. This is important for protecting our planet’s resources and minimizing the need for new landfill sites.

Lower Carbon Emissions
Fewer pickups mean fewer trucks on the road, which helps lower carbon emissions. When businesses use trash compactor services, the number of trips to landfills decreases. This not only saves fuel but also contributes to cleaner air in our communities.

Recycling Enhancement
Dumpster compactors can also improve recycling efforts. With better sorting and compacting of materials, more recyclables can be diverted from landfills. This supports a circular economy, where materials are reused instead of wasted, benefiting both businesses and the environment.
